rooster59 Posted July 27, 2019 Share Posted July 27, 2019 Four Chinese arrested in Ayuthaya for working without a work permit Image: Naew Na Immigration police and Department of Employment officials in Ayuthaya went to a company in Uthai district yesterday where they arrested four Chinese nationals for working illegally. The Chinese were charged with working without a work permit. They were handed over to the Uthai police to be prosecuted. No names were given and the company involved was not reported in the Naew Na story. Thaivisa notes that Naew Na are reporting daily on the activities of Thai immigration nationwide.
